Virgilio Barco Vargas

Virgilio Barco Vargas (September 17, 1921 – May 20, 1997) was a politician and diplomat from Colombia. He was a member of the Colombian Liberal Party and served as president of Colombia from August 7, 1986 until August 7, 1990. Barco was born in Cúcuta, Norte de Santander Department, in north-eastern Colombia.
